What price means to WordPress hosting?

Please keep in mind that the cheapest host is not always the best, it’s just an equation between costs and the services that the company offers. In our case, iPage is always the cheapest WordPress hosting, but, you will get a medium quality hosting compared to the first 2 companies in the above table. So, you’ve to choose the right service based on your budget and website needs at the same time.

What WordPress needs as hosting?

WordPress is a PHP and MySQL software, that means complicated requests and lots of operations for every page view. Also, not every server can work well with lots of requests, it can work slower, or it can top completely in others cases. In other words, WordPress will work better and faster with servers that are optimized for speed and performance.
